How do I treat blisters on my feet?

To treat a blister, dermatologists recommend the following: Cover the blister Loosely cover the blister with a bandage Use padding To protect blisters in pressure areas, such as the bottom of your feet, use padding Avoid popping or draining a blister, as this could lead to infection Keep the area clean and covered

Is Vaseline good for blisters?

Plain petroleum jelly is a favorite among dermatologists for the treatment of wounds Although the blister itself will act as a covering for the wound, if it happens to break, a person can cover the area with Vaseline and a bandage This may promote healing of the area

How do I stop walking with blisters?

Blisters Wear comfortable, good-fitting, worn-in boots or shoes – especially on long walks Wear good walking socks in the right size – wearing two pairs of socks can help prevent rubbing Immediately remove anything from your socks or boots which causes irritation

Should I put a bandaid on a blister?

Cover your blister with a bandage, if needed A bandage can help prevent the blister from being torn or popped If the blister does break open, a bandage can will keep the area clean prevent infection Use a bandage that is large enough to cover the entire blister

Why do blisters refill?

The liquid-filled bubble of skin is actually a natural form of protection that helps shield the wound from harmful bacteria Blisters also provide a safe space for new skin to grow As new skin grows, your body will slowly reabsorb the fluid After a few days, your blister will dry up and flake off
